油茶果实和叶片中主要营养物质含量的变化规律  被引量:46

Content variation of main nutrients in leaves and fruits of Camellia oleifera

摘  要:以6年生普通油茶‘湘林210’为试材,研究其果实生长发育过程中当年生叶片、2年生叶片和果实中可溶性糖、可溶性蛋白质以及油脂含量的变化规律及相关性。结果表明:4月上旬至10月下旬,当年生和2年生叶片中的可溶性糖含量变化均呈双峰型,果实中的可溶性糖含量变化呈三峰型;可溶性蛋白质含量的变化在当年生叶片、2年生叶片和果实中的变化趋势基本一致,均为三峰型;果实中油脂含量从7月底开始逐渐增加直至果实成熟时达到最高值;当年生和2年生叶片中的可溶性糖含量之间呈极显著正相关关系(r=0.791),当年生和2年生叶片中的可溶性蛋白质之间呈显著正相关关系(r=0.579),果实与叶片中的可溶性蛋白质含量呈极显著正相关关系(r=0.721)。The 6-year-old Camellia oleifera 'Xianglin 210' was used to study the content variation of main nutrients in 1-year-old leaves, 2-year-old leaves and fruits, and their correlation. The results show that with the growth of the fruits from the first ten days of April to the late ten days of October, the content of soluble sugar in 2- year-old leaves and 1-year-old leaves showed a double peak type, while that in fruits showed a three peak type; the changing trend of their soluble protein were similar, their changing curves all showed a three peak type; the content of soluble sugar in 1 year leaves was positively(P〈0.01) correlated with that in 2 years leaves; The content of soluble protein in 1-year-old leaves was negatively ( P 〈0.05) correlated with that in 2-year-old leaves; the content of soluble protein in fruits was positively(P〈0.01) correlated with that in 2-year-old leaves.
